hello erick , welcome to the forums . if you can take care of neps then you can take care of all sorts of cps . all sarracenia are easy to take care of , more easier then neps . they love sun and lots of water and they love humidity but they don't really need it . if your gonna get sarracenia i'd say start a bigger collection with venus flytraps , sundews , bladderworts and butterworts . they will grow happly whjere you live , but they will need dormancy requirments but you can improvise it with a refrigerator .
